What do you need to know about intrauterine insemination?
IUI Includes placing washed sperm directly into the uterus around the time of ovulation. It bypasses the cervix facilitating the journey of sperm into fallopian tubes to fertilize the egg. You can be the right candidate for the treatment if you are dealing with low sperm count or decreased mortality or even irregular or absent evaluation. The success rates are likely to vary but are generally lower than IVF treatment. Factors impacting the success include sperm quality, female age and underlying fertility issues. You need to know that IUI is less invasive and typically includes fewer medicines and lower costs as compared to IVF but multiple cycles might be needed to achieve pregnancy.
In vitro fertilization
IVF is actually a multi step process. Firstly medicines will stimulate the ovaries to produce multiple eggs. Then the mature eggs will be retrieved via a minor surgical procedure. Next eggs will be fertilized with sperm or even a lab setting. The fertilized eggs will develop into embryos over the next few days. One or more embryos will be transferred to the uterus for potential implantation. You can go for the treatment if you are dealing with severe sperm issues or blocked or damaged fallopian tubes. There can be chances of decreased ovarian reserve or age-related fertility decline.

Making an informed decision
- IUI Basically has success rates ranging from 10% to 20% per cycle while the success rates for IVF range anywhere between 30% to 60% per cycle depending on different factors.
- You need to know that IUI is generally more affordable per cycle as compared to IVF. But cumulative costs might be higher if multiple IUI cycles are required. You need to check with your insurance provider for coverage details as benefits can vary greatly.
- Both IUI and IVF can evoke intense emotions. The level of emotional investment might differ due to treatment intensity, success rates and personal expectations. The support systems and coping strategies are really important for navigating the emotional challenges.
